{"product_id":"general-electric-ic693mdl330-series-90-30-ac-output-module","title":"General Electric IC693MDL330 Series 90-30 AC Output Module","description":"\u003ch3\u003eDescription\u003c\/h3\u003e\n\u003cp\u003eThe General Electric IC693MDL330 is an 8-point discrete AC output module designed for use within the Series 90-30 Programmable Logic Controller (PLC) platform. Operating at 120\/240 volts AC, this module provides reliable switching capabilities for industrial automation environments. It features two isolated groups of four output points each, with a separate common associated with every group. Because the internal commons are not tied together, individual groups can operate on different phases of an AC supply or be powered by independent supplies.\u003c\/p\u003e\n\u003cp\u003eEach group is internally protected by a 5 amp fuse, and built-in RC snubbers protect each output against transient electrical noise generated on power lines. The module supports a high inrush current rating of up to 10 times the rated current, making it ideal for controlling demanding inductive and incandescent loads.
